Fuel filter change

I have been changing the fuel filter on my 04 for ever. I had the strangest thing happen. I got a fuel filter from Dodge this week and for the life of me I couldn’t get the lid down on the canister. This is usually a 10 minute job I am wondering if they gave me the wrong filter. I finally put the old filter back in to get me through the weekend. Its like the filter it is too tall.

Anyone else have this happen?

When you take it apart again drain the housing completely and look at the bottom of the stand pipe. I have read of the rubber seal on the bottom of the filter coming off and staying on the stand pipe. If that occurred the new filter would not go in because the old seal would be in the way.

Nick thanks for the tip. that was the deal. After removing old seal the new filter went on as normal. man i feel like an idiot.
